Job Description

Employment Type: Full-Time Employment

Work Setup: Onsite onboarding for a two to four weeks, followed by a transition to a remote setup.

Work Schedule: Night Shift (Following U.S. Pacific Time Zone)

Location: Eastwood, Libis, Quezon City

Salary Package: 60,000 PHP to 65,000 PHP/Monthly

About The Client

A forensic technology and expert services firm based inUnited Statesthat helps legal teams analyze, visualize, and present complex evidence in court.

The Role

We are seeking a Senior Sales & Pipeline Manager to take ownership of our client acquisition, pipeline management, and daily sales

operations. This role is designed for a strategic sales leader and strong executor—someone who can confidently lead scoping calls with US attorneys, close high-ticket B2B deals, and manage the daily accountability of our Sales team. Your primary objective is to drive revenue, maintain a flawless CRM pipeline, and ensure a seamless transition of closed deals over to our Production Project Managers.

Key Responsibilities

Sales Leadership & Client Acquisition

  • Own the full sales lifecycle:
    • Inbound and outbound lead management
    • Lead qualification via email and phone (fluent English required)
    • Conduct and lead scoping calls with clients and internal experts
    • Define project scope based on client needs and technical feasibility
    • Take full responsibility for the final execution of contracts and retention agreements with the client.
    • Close deals and ensure successful transition to production.
  • Act as the primary client-facing lead during the sales process
  • Build trust with attorneys, insurers, and expert stakeholders
  • Ensure accuracy in scope, expectations, and deliverables
  • Pipeline & Process Management:
    • Own and manage CRM workflows (e.g., Wrike or equivalent)
    • Track all opportunities across pipeline stages:
      • New leads
      • Qualified opportunities
      • Proposal stage
      • Closed won / closed lost
    • Maintain clean, timely, and accurate documentation:
      • Client communications
      • Meeting notes
      • Next steps and follow-ups
    • Build and analyze pipeline reports:
      • Lead volume and sources
      • Conversion rates
      • Sales cycle timing
      • Revenue forecasting
    • Identify gaps and implement process improvements
Team Management & Accountability

  • Manage, mentor, and direct the daily activities of the Business Development (BD) and Sales team members.
  • Track team performance metrics closely, providing timely, constructive feedback to foster continuous improvement.
  • Keep direct reports strictly accountable to their daily deliverables, client follow-ups, and CRM data entry tasks.
  • Establish clear sales processes, expectations, and performance standards to build a highly self-sufficient sales engine.

Production Coordination

  • Ensure a seamless transition and handoff from Sales to the Production/Project Management team after a deal closes.
  • Align client expectations with internal production capabilities prior to closing to prevent scope creep.
  • Act as the bridge between Sales and Production, ensuring all stakeholders are aligned on timelines and deliverable expectations.

Cross-Functional Marketing Collaboration

  • Actively participate in day-to-day marketing initiatives in collaboration with the current internal team.
  • Support the execution of marketing tasks (e.g., email campaigns, LinkedIn outreach, conference material updates) as a secondary function to help align marketing efforts with the overarching sales strategy.

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elors Degree (in Business, Marketing, or Accounting is a plus) 5+ years of pure B2B sales experience, specifically managing a full sales lifecycle.
  • Proven experience leading client-facing scoping discussions, negotiating, and closing deals.
  • Proven experience managing teams, tracking performance, providing timely constructive feedback, and keeping direct reports accountable.
  • Strong management skills with a track record of holding sales teams accountable to daily metrics and deliverables.
  • Expertise in CRM systems, pipeline tracking, and revenue forecasting.
  • Exceptional written and verbal English communication skills; comfortable speaking with high-level legal professionals.
  • Highly organized with the ability to build and enforce Standard
  • Operating Procedures (SOPs).
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Ability to work independently while collaborating with remote teams

Preferred (Nice-to-Haves)

  • Digital Marketing Experience: Familiarity with running or supporting marketing campaigns (email, LinkedIn organic/paid, Google Ads) is a strong plus.
  • Experience working with U.S.-based clients, particularly in the legal, insurance, or technical/engineering industries.
  • Experience working in an agency setting or coordinating closely with technical production teams.
